What Are Battery Connectors?
Battery connector are electrical terminals that link a battery to a device, charger, or power system. They ensure a secure and efficient flow of electricity, preventing power loss and electrical hazards. These connectors come in various shapes, sizes, and materials, depending on the application and voltage/current requirements.
Why Are Battery Connectors Important?
Reliable Power Transfer – They maintain a steady connection for uninterrupted power delivery.
Safety – High-quality connectors prevent short circuits, overheating, and fire risks.
Efficiency – Proper connectors reduce resistance, ensuring optimal battery performance and longer lifespan.
Compatibility – Different connectors allow batteries to work with a variety of devices and power systems.
Ease of Use – Many connectors feature quick-release or snap-in designs for easy installation and replacement.
Common Types of Battery Connectors
Anderson Connectors – Used in industrial and automotive applications.
XT Connectors (XT60, XT90) – Popular in drones and RC vehicles for high-power needs.
Tamiya Connectors – Found in airsoft guns and RC cars.
SAE Connectors – Common in motorcycles and solar panel setups.
Ring Terminals – Used for secure battery terminal connections in vehicles and marine applications.
